The Challenge of Commercial Insurance Renewals
Renewing commercial insurance policies is more than just sending out a new bill. It requires a deep understanding of a client's evolving business. Changes in operations, staffing, or assets can impact coverage needs.
Consider a small manufacturing business. They might add new machinery or expand their workforce. These changes affect their property, liability, and workers' compensation needs. An insurance agent must review these details carefully. They need to ensure the policy still provides adequate protection. This often means manual data collection and analysis.
Many businesses also face risks like employment practice liability. Understanding these risks is key. For example, employment practices liability insurance (EPLI) protects against claims from employees. This includes wrongful termination or discrimination. The Insurance Information Institute (Triple-I) explains EPLI claims. AI can help agents quickly identify if a client's evolving business needs updated EPLI coverage discussions.
How AI Transforms Commercial Insurance Renewals
AI brings efficiency and precision to the renewal cycle. It automates repetitive tasks. It also provides agents with valuable insights. This leads to a more effective and personalized client experience.
Data Aggregation and Analysis
One of the biggest hurdles in renewals is data collection. Businesses change. Their risk profiles shift. AI can gather and process vast amounts of data quickly.
An automated commercial policy renewal process uses AI to:
- Extract data: AI tools can pull information from various sources. This includes past policies, claims history, and public business records.
- Identify changes: It can flag significant changes in a client's business. This might be a new address, increased revenue, or a change in industry classification.
- Update profiles: AI helps maintain accurate and up-to-date client profiles. This reduces manual data entry errors.
This automation means agents spend less time on administrative work. They gain more time for client interaction.
Risk Assessment and Underwriting Support
AI enhances the ability to assess risk for renewals. It uses advanced algorithms to analyze data points. This helps predict potential claims or coverage gaps.
Commercial insurance renewal optimization AI tools can:
- Spot trends: Identify patterns in claims data. This helps agents anticipate future risks.
- Suggest coverage adjustments: Based on updated risk profiles, AI can recommend specific policy changes. For example, if a client adds a fleet of vehicles, AI might flag the need for commercial auto insurance review. Triple-I provides guidance on business vehicle insurance. AI helps ensure such discussions happen.
- Expedite quotes: By automating parts of the underwriting process, AI speeds up quote generation. This allows agents to present options faster.
Personalized Outreach and Communication
Client retention is crucial. AI helps agents deliver a more personalized renewal experience. This strengthens client relationships.
AI agent assist for insurance renewals empowers agents to:
- Tailor messages: AI can analyze client history and suggest personalized communication. This includes custom emails or talking points for calls.
- Proactive engagement: It can identify clients who might be at risk of not renewing. This allows agents to reach out proactively.
- Offer relevant products: Based on client data, AI can suggest additional coverages. These are products that genuinely meet the client's evolving needs.
These AI for insurance client retention strategies move beyond generic renewal notices. They foster trust and show clients their unique needs are understood.
Compliance and Documentation
Maintaining compliance is non-negotiable in insurance. AI helps ensure all renewal steps meet regulatory requirements. It also assists in proper documentation.
AI tools can:
- Verify data accuracy: Cross-reference information to reduce errors in renewal documents.
- Generate audit trails: Keep detailed records of all interactions and decisions. This supports compliance audits.
- Flag missing information: Alert agents to any incomplete forms or required disclosures.
AI Implementation Readiness for Insurance Renewals: A Checklist
Before deploying AI, prepare your team and systems. A smooth transition ensures maximum benefit.
Consider these points for AI implementation readiness for insurance renewals:
- Data Quality: Is your client data clean, accurate, and accessible? AI performs best with high-quality input.
- System Integration: Can new AI tools connect with your existing CRM, policy administration, and claims systems?
- Team Training: Are your agents and staff ready to learn new AI-powered workflows? Provide clear training and support.
- Clear Goals: What specific problems do you want AI to solve? Define measurable objectives for success.
- Phased Rollout: Start with a pilot program. Test AI with a small group before full deployment.
- Compliance Review: Ensure your AI strategy aligns with all industry regulations and privacy laws.

What AI tools help insurance agents with renewals?
Several types of AI tools assist agents with renewals.
- Data analytics platforms: These tools analyze large datasets to identify trends, predict risks, and suggest coverage adjustments.
- Natural Language Processing (NLP) solutions: NLP helps extract key information from unstructured data. This includes policy documents, emails, and claims notes. It can also help draft personalized client communications.
- Predictive modeling: These models forecast which clients are most likely to renew or churn. They also predict potential coverage gaps.
- Chatbots and virtual assistants: While not replacing agents, these tools can handle routine client inquiries. They can also provide agents with quick access to policy information. This allows agents to focus on complex client needs.
- Workflow automation tools: These AI-powered systems automate repetitive tasks. This includes data entry, document generation, and scheduling follow-ups.
These tools work together to create a more streamlined and effective renewal workflow.
Measuring Success: Key Metrics to Track
To ensure your AI investment pays off, track specific performance indicators.
- Renewal Rate: The percentage of policies successfully renewed. This is a primary measure of success.
- Agent Efficiency: Measure the time agents spend on renewals before and after AI implementation. Look for reductions in administrative tasks.
- Client Satisfaction: Use surveys to gauge client happiness with the renewal process.
- Cross-Sell/Up-Sell Rate: Track how often agents successfully offer additional coverage. AI insights should drive these opportunities.
- Error Reduction: Monitor the decrease in data entry errors or compliance issues related to renewals.
- Cost Savings: Calculate savings from reduced manual labor and improved operational efficiency.
